コード例 #1
0
ファイル: NetMapBufferPool.cs プロジェクト: InJoins/Magma
 public NetMapBufferPool(ushort bufferLength, IntPtr bufferStart, uint numberOfBuffers)
 {
     _memoryPool = new NetMapOwnedMemory[numberOfBuffers];
     for (var i = 0; i < numberOfBuffers; i++)
     {
         _memoryPool[i] = new NetMapOwnedMemory(IntPtr.Add(bufferStart, i * bufferLength), bufferLength, (uint)i);
     }
 }
コード例 #2
0
 public NetMapMemoryWrapper(NetMapOwnedMemory ownedMemory) => _ownedMemory = ownedMemory;